6608-- Discussion Sheet

# 6608-- Discussion Sheet - EXAMINATION DISCUSSION LESSON...

EXAMINATION DISCUSSION LESSON 6608 (25 Questions) 68CH11 PROGRAMMING, PART A To assist you in your review of this lesson we have prepared this discussion sheet. We suggest that you read the discussion on questions you had right as well as on questions you missed. 1. (2) 8 … Study Guide and Fig. 3.2 on page 55 of the textbook. 2. (4) status … Study Guide. 3. (1) b 0 of the CCR… Fig. 3.2 of the textbook. 4. (2) the 2’s complement system … Study Guide and discussion of the N bit in Section 3.1 of the textbook. 5. (4) BCD numbers … Discussion of H bit in Section 3.1 of the textbook; also see Chapter Question #1 on page 88 of the textbook, as well as its answer in the Study Guide. 6. (4) The DAA instruction is used to convert numbers from binary into decimal … Section 3.3, Subsection BCD Addition. The DAA only provides proper adjustment of numbers when two valid BCD numbers are added. If they are binary numbers, the DAA instruction will not change them to decimal properly. 7. (2) is set if an operation may have produced an invalid result … Study Guide and Section 3.1, discussion of the V bit on page 56 of the textbook. 8. (3) logic 1 … The Study Guide has been using “set (logic 1)” and “clear (logic 0)” since the first assignment. 9. (1) set … The SUBB instruction is in the IMM (immediate) mode, so that it will subtract the operand \$07 from the contents of the B accumulator, which are also \$07. This will leave a \$00 in the B accumulator. The Z bit is set whenever an operation results in a zero, as described in Section 3.1, discussion of the Z bit

